From mboxrd@z Thu Jan 1 00:00:00 1970 X-Spam-Checker-Version: SpamAssassin 3.4.4 (2020-01-24) on inbox.vuxu.org X-Spam-Level: X-Spam-Status: No, score=-3.3 required=5.0 tests=DKIM_SIGNED,DKIM_VALID, MAILING_LIST_MULTI,RCVD_IN_DNSWL_MED,T_SCC_BODY_TEXT_LINE, UNPARSEABLE_RELAY autolearn=ham autolearn_force=no version=3.4.4 Received: (qmail 10802 invoked from network); 9 Jul 2022 03:12:16 -0000 Received: from zero.zsh.org (2a02:898:31:0:48:4558:7a:7368) by inbox.vuxu.org with ESMTPUTF8; 9 Jul 2022 03:12:16 -0000 ARC-Seal: i=1; cv=none; a=rsa-sha256; d=zsh.org; s=rsa-20210803; t=1657336336; b=UBGTIhoPz3IWVAFItFFGbo0RzUXqKDPUbkUJD5wgoWGyjI0M7d86fEd0anZjawwUHLJJUGlQ1n 2ICtgQIk3bwDyQl4RLM1G3xt2HO5eyiMJeZ4SryF5LqdRECLCxq/44URPtF6vqvp4swUrFm9oi j8C5f9PRNJg3bv6xEahVfQX/Y6cu8dvh5a60OVztEcgj1tQLuZ6BDnknfiSHwZcFkt+e3zvRMf MHWfjM/B6jWlNMZoq/HYYKT4PGxGZrQBud0SjcXMxd4Q1zWLmxlBShNkHC1/VAt5R0Ih8WaOyr H7LcTGX/8BFgJW4Ef9izKdCEzpUucYN94mo7PV4Q26lX2A==; ARC-Authentication-Results: i=1; zsh.org; iprev=pass (mail-ej1-f52.google.com) smtp.remote-ip=209.85.218.52; dkim=pass header.d=brasslantern-com.20210112.gappssmtp.com header.s=20210112 header.a=rsa-sha256; dmarc=none header.from=brasslantern.com; arc=none 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ed; d=zsh.org; s=rsa-20210803; t=1657336336; bh=HXTAIzAbym4EdXV0wOCZ19NlIvL/Ag6d5vNJp0C8ShQ=; h=List-Archive:List-Owner:List-Post:List-Unsubscribe:List-Subscribe:List-Help: List-Id:Sender:Content-Type:Cc:To:Subject:Message-ID:Date:From:In-Reply-To: References:MIME-Version:DKIM-Signature:DKIM-Signature; b=Md3CE0DXE438yB25nInYKiKsFaPR1KebVNSHNR3RVrOocDqx8NDYiZkpeYGk8pa8PM+I8xf3FQ AWXrOIT8qX+mwChqJvUWCfF8WvKMOJPxHJw8CQR4ytKaXbRByefZtdo6vqd185WxLmpPCiz/J1 9FvmYmonj0ZY2NAHgb3JjMgqDce2saOS8wdjKeW0PuiiyOfvETu2VnruIPp2O1lzxOwYf6EMer g1RL+gPJ3lFL+HpBgdW3bLYv1swV6147jF0KIZwVYeuFQOKZZ6shEkIOyLvs78nydL/r0KQRYz /V3Xsd5tdZE8gLUkuHoyeU4vbxs1cT8/2uoDtytizx7SVA==; D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=zsh.org; s=rsa-20210803; h=List-Archive:List-Owner:List-Post:List-Unsubscribe: List-Subscribe:List-Help:List-Id:Sender:Content-Type:Cc:To:Subject:Message-ID :Date:From:In-Reply-To:References:MIME-Version:Reply-To: Content-Transfer-Encoding:Content-ID:Content-Description:Resent-Date: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ID; bh=ziMG7JAqzKxwV8+fZLEm+heJUYx/5VoEswT6fnHqLo0=; b=ODiHhuzjHXXliYjb2TJEusp4fO +M0u7s+ZBIBhPEaViejGIMOnFKE2qgNTMpMH6DKrULk3H42vW23Qyisz9/N09iboNJYMOgyXxdlgo UN49tE06TH/6O/xJOC3/k+AhuslBqsXkjiIWYi3vipKWptwSzR5V7wJjnOfrSEpZhhTdFyqAdplYo mUgIoHiZo/IJ1cOI8Lc56gLo67sbZiS+jq3DZS8VyKcwxsqiwteLWG3m4oDGJGQnnNxoWYncfKG4N 3dRudSDZy1KyvfV9ttZjYN1sEpzcd5yb2vZhpUStcDZGm9u5v9zzqBVLxno1vRxi946kKhf08DbMU 79dhL1nw==; Received: from authenticated user by zero.zsh.org with local id 1oA0tD-00030o-JI; Sat, 09 Jul 2022 03:12:15 +0000 Authentication-Results: zsh.org; iprev=pass (mail-ej1-f52.google.com) smtp.remote-ip=209.85.218.52; dkim=pass header.d=brasslantern-com.20210112.gappssmtp.com header.s=20210112 header.a=rsa-sha256; dmarc=none header.from=brasslantern.com; arc=none Received: from mail-ej1-f52.google.com ([209.85.218.52]:42726) by zero.zsh.org with esmtps (TLS1.3:TLS_AES_128_GCM_SHA256:128) id 1oA0s4-0002KD-Jy; Sat, 09 Jul 2022 03:11:05 +0000 Received: by mail-ej1-f52.google.com with SMTP id sz17so567705ejc.9 for ; Fri, 08 Jul 2022 20:11:04 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=brasslantern-com.20210112.gappssmtp.com; s=20210112;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c; bh=ziMG7JAqzKxwV8+fZLEm+heJUYx/5VoEswT6fnHqLo0=; b=InRY31+OvhDs1wK2LXPTM9o1m9J1RghHLk36JhOPFFDXC05a0V0dZbesganFmlr8go +eLJj753mEilqlTEdQLXaMaYGOxZtkNR3vccs8ga7h6DBM6sKLSGvPZ8aJJSthEf5DfW 8JzQyDoqTysGdcuJYLoQfL0OcVFknIHNn9HcGMLt9thGIEkYWFP2mDEMbXtrTm0ipAzt xAZgtjqcJIHOCCaQGbIvZA2yq9VHpddvtc+9W0J/E2cN9OB2N73t+GY34BTCRjZNmqZp rEg8ghVX/jbsRsNGTK3Ie2J2E2G4HkS9fW0ifsrz3GY1XUOEaVKk+TqbpniT/mxaLcTp VOBQ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c; bh=ziMG7JAqzKxwV8+fZLEm+heJUYx/5VoEswT6fnHqLo0=; b=h8besK+2h+mmYLPIR2mLDA4JmrDjFmMPCioLENGPIZpspaD6PdhRqPvnfTXbNHpww0 esBqtwOeLgIZRz/DNc6T8/mD3zWbOZZr+DhLidw0k1aICxRyMZLquJTB8z8zi9W93Rzu dIqGg3ZKDJcAT6GbULCo9VDSsQaiYOyj4DkrxksWGEhIjVM4q9LDxy2e/ZUGfwX+XLfr X1z9166NYMj6xJyHbsl05AQAw9hscgQOEXnP+iv05hJwUIv0v1cpUanjcWzXXWwwk3Q4 XxhfcF2LD0NJn8ELPYH+TLWUVNPgt8V2M1MR1A8er9HZJIPn6Mw7syNMFlL9KwXnt/wr mNjg== X-Gm-Message-State: AJIora+ana3Gkqfhhqiq/GzGUSmk44cAFtMIH/gJYqIDKA2Gui/3eUTR 99lBL13DGYfiRbuhh7z9EJG7rsv19cMjdLKz9Bc88ORkQc9Heg== X-Google-Smtp-Source: AGRyM1uInuUXHrpMT91wNyypnUqpPyUgbWpdr4or9xzjoYXGkUhKqBiKsxOCK9K1ssAgBoTlkMpqUQq4YyWuO1alZ+U= X-Received: by 2002:a17:907:28d6:b0:72a:f121:b71 with SMTP id en22-20020a17090728d600b0072af1210b71mr6697582ejc.732.1657336264054; Fri, 08 Jul 2022 20:11:04 -0700 (PDT) MIME-Version: 1.0 References: In-Reply-To: From: Bart Schaefer Date: Fri, 8 Jul 2022 20:10:52 -0700 Message-ID: Subject: Re: Magic URL quoting and bracketed paste gets "disabled" randomly To: Vincent Bernat Cc: Zsh Users Content-Type: text/plain; charset="UTF-8" X-Seq: 27880 Archived-At: X-Loop: zsh-users@zsh.org Errors-To: zsh-users-owner@zsh.org Precedence: list Precedence: bulk Sender: zsh-users-request@zsh.org X-no-archive: yes List-Id: List-Help: List-Subscribe: List-Unsubscribe: List-Post: List-Owner: List-Archive: On Wed, Jul 6, 2022 at 11:13 PM Vincent Bernat wrote: > > zle -N self-insert url-quote-magic > zle -N bracketed-paste bracketed-paste-magic > > It works fine, but after some time, [url-quote-magic] stops working. > Bracketed paste never stops working. First thing to check is whether any of your widgets have become re-bound somehow. zle -l -L bracketed-paste self-insert should return zle -N bracketed-paste bracketed-paste-magic zle -N self-insert url-quote-magic If that hasn't changed, does url-quote-magic work when just typing in a URL without pasting? If so, next I'd try exec 2>/tmp/zshuqmtrace functions -t url-quote-magic and then paste a URL. See if you get anything in that trace file.